The following members were present: mayor HIl ed council Neils Seibold and Spaeth The following rs were sent: unci man un Councilman Spaeth introduced the following Resolution and moved its tion: RESOLUTION #77-340 AUTHORIZING THE VACATION OF "TOWN ROAD" BETWEEN SECTIONS 22 AND 23 WITHIN PLYMOUTH (A-717) WHEREAS, a petition to vacate Town Road from County Road 154 to its westerly terminus has been received by the City Council from the property owners adjacent to Town Road between County Road 154 and its westerly terminus; AND, WHEREAS, a public hearing with respect to said vacation was held on July 11, 1977 in accordance with Minnesota Statutes, 412.851, as amended; AND, WHEREAS, a notice of publication of said hearing was published and posted two weeks prior to the meeting of July 11, 1977; AND, WHEREAS, the Council did hold a public hearing on July 11, 1977 to inform any 10 and all interested parties relevant to the vacation of Town Road between County Road 154 and its westerly terminus; AND, WHEREAS, it was determined by the City Council that Town Road is not needed for a public street; N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T HEREBY R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F PLYMOUTH, MINNESOTA, as follows: 1. That Town Road from County Road 154 to its westerly terminus at the west line of the northeast quarter of the southeast quarter of Section 22, Range 22, Township 118 be vacated. 2. That said vacation shall not affect the authority of any person, corporation or municipality owning or controlling electric or telephone poles and lines, Das and sewer lines, or water pipes, mains and hydrants thereon or thereunder, to continue maintaining the same or to enter upon such way or portion thereof vacated to repair, replace, remove or otherwise attend thereto. The motion for the adoption of the foregoing Resolution was duly seconded by Councilman Neils , and upon vote being taken thereon, the following voted in favorthereof: Mayor Hilde, Councilmen Neil, Seibold and Spaeth Whereupon the CRs Lst or abstained: NO-: was declared duly passed and adopted.
